Ingredients
Scale
For the Filling:
- 3 medium tart apples (like Granny Smith), peeled and diced
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tsp cinnamon
For the Pastry:
- 2 sheets puff pastry (thawed if frozen)
- 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
Instructions
For the Filling:
- 1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- 2. In a bowl, toss diced apples with sugar and cinnamon until well coated.
For the Pastry:
- 1. Roll out puff pastry on a floured surface to an eighth-inch thickness.
- 2. Cut the pastry into squares large enough to hold filling without overflowing.
- 3. Place a spoonful of apple filling in the center of each square.
- 4. Fold each square into triangles and seal edges with a fork.
- 5. Brush tops with beaten egg for a golden finish.
- Baking:
- 1. Arrange turnovers on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
- 2.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until puffed and golden brown.
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
